Title(EN): Downloading FTP Directory Recursively with PythonAuthor: dog2需求快速批量下载多个FTP服务器的上的目录(指定目录或整个目录)。分析核心问题:针对一个FTP Server,要能够下载其指定目录。即递归遍历所有目录,针对每个目录中的子目录,创建本地相应目录;针对每个目录中的文件下载到本地相应目录。下载所有文件的过程最
本文实例讲述了python实现支持目录FTP上传下载文件的方法。分享给大家供大家参考。具体如下:该程序支持ftp上传下载文件和目录、适用于windows和linux平台。#!/usr/bin/env python # -*- coding: utf-8 -*- import ftplib import os import sys class FTPSync(object): conn = ftpl
Python ftplib模块 ftp登陆连接 from ftplib import FTP #加载ftp模块 ftp=FTP() #设置变量 ftp.set_debuglevel(2) #打开调试级别2,显示详细信息 ftp.connect("IP","port") #连接的ftp
本文实例讲述了python实现支持目录FTP上传下载文件的方法。分享给大家供大家参考。具体如下:该程序支持ftp上传下载文件和目录、适用于windows和linux平台。#!/usr/bin/env python # -*- coding: utf-8 -*- import ftplib import os import sys class FTPSync(object): conn = ftpl
转载 2024-06-13 14:26:53
61阅读
本文实例讲述了python实现的简单FTP上传下载文件的方法。分享给大家供大家参考。具体如下:python本身自带一个FTP模块,可以实现上传下载的函数功能。#!/usr/bin/env python # -*- coding: utf-8 -*- from ftplib import FTP def ftp_up(filename = "20120904.rar"): ftp=FTP() ftp
转载 2023-06-02 13:05:16
140阅读
# coding:utf-8 ''' 将文件名称重命名 将上级的文件名称添加到文件名称中 ''' import os file_path1 = r"D:\安装包\传智播客python" file_name1 = os.listdir(file_path1) file_name1 = file_name1[0:13]#去除其他不需要操作的文件 for file_name in file_
转载 2023-06-02 14:37:03
310阅读
## Python ftplib 下载整个文件夹 在进行文件传输时,FTP(File Transfer Protocol)是一种常用的协议。Python 中的 ftplib 模块提供了对 FTP 服务器的访问功能,可以方便地进行文件的上传和下载操作。在本文中,我们将介绍如何使用 Pythonftplib 模块下载整个文件夹。 ### 什么是 ftplibftplib 是 Pytho
原创 2024-03-27 04:07:32
239阅读
国内源阿里云:https://mirrors.aliyun.com/pypi/simple/ 清华:https://pypi.tuna.tsinghua.edu.cn/simple 中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/ 华中理工大学:http://pypi.hustunique.com/ 山东理工大学:http://pypi.sdutlin
转载 2023-08-01 00:28:12
142阅读
Python提供了几种从Internet下载文件的方法。 可以使用urllib包或请求库通过HTTP完成。 本教程将讨论如何使用这些库使用Python从URL下载文件。 要求 请求库是Python中最受欢迎的库之一。 请求允许您发送 HTTP / 1.1请求,而无需手动将查询字符串添加到您的URL或对POST数据进行表单编码。 使用请求库,您可以执行许多功能,包括: 添加表格数据, 添加
转载 2023-08-17 10:34:54
264阅读
from flask import Flask,request,Responseapp = Flask(__name__)@app.route(
原创 2023-02-04 01:20:31
124阅读
# Python 下载文件 在编程和数据分析的过程中,我们经常需要从网络上下载文件Python 提供了多种方法和库来实现文件下载的功能。本文将介绍常用的几种方法,并给出相应的代码示例。 ## urllib 库 urllib 是 Python 内置的一个 HTTP 请求库,可以用来发送 HTTP 请求并处理 HTTP 响应。通过 urllib 库,我们可以直接从网络上下载文件。下面是一个使用
原创 2023-08-27 08:10:10
155阅读
使用python下载文件可以使用urllib模块的urlretrieve函数,使用非常简单,第一个o1():
原创 2023-01-30 19:18:58
155阅读
# Python下载文件的实现 ## 简介 在Python中,我们可以使用一些库和模块来实现文件下载。本文将介绍一种常见的方法,它使用了`requests`库来发送HTTP请求,并使用`open()`函数将文件保存到本地。 ## 整体流程 下面是实现下载文件的整体流程,可以用表格展示步骤: | 步骤 | 描述 | | --- | --- | | 1 | 导入所需的模块和库 | | 2 |
原创 2023-07-28 08:03:40
68阅读
下载文件主要会用到 urllib、urllib2、requests 这三个库,其中requests主要用到的是 urllib3。由于还没深入了解这一块,所以先记录以下基本的用法。如果是执行简单的下载操作:urllib.urlretrieve(url, save_path)如果需要对获取完url的内容之后进行操作,如解码后进一步处理数据,则可以采用以下方式获取数据:req = urllib2.url
压缩文件可以直接放到下载器里面下载的 you-get 连接 下载任意文件 重点 用python下载文件的若干种方法汇总 写文章 用python下载文件的若干种方法汇总 在这篇文章中:1. 下载图片2. 下载重定向的文件3. 分块下载文件4. 并行下载文件5. 使用urllib获取html页面6. python下载视频的神器7. 举个例子 在日常科研或者工作中,
       今天我们一起学习如何使用不同的Python模块从web下载文件。此外,你将下载常规文件、web页面、Amazon S3和其他资源。最后,你将学习如何克服可能遇到的各种挑战,例如下载重定向的文件下载大型文件、完成一个多线程下载以及其他策略。1、使用requests你可以使用requests模块从一个URL下载文件。考虑以下代码: 你只需使用
1、使用requests你可以使用requests模块从一个URL下载文件。考虑以下代码:你只需使用requests模块的get方法获取URL,并将结果存储到一个名为“myfile”的变量中。然后,将这个变量的内容写入文件。2、使用wget你还可以使用Python的wget模块从一个URL下载文件。你可以使用pip按以下命令安装wget模块:考虑以下代码,我们将使用它下载Python的logo图像
实现效果:通过url所绑定的关键名创建目录名,每次访问一个网页url后把文件下载下来代码:其中 data[i][0]、data[i][1] 是代表 关键词(文件保存目录)、网站链接(要下载文件的网站)def getDriverHttp():for i in range(reCount): # 创建Chrome浏览器配置对象实例 chromeOptions = webdriver.ChromeOpt
转载 2024-07-29 12:26:50
117阅读
# 如何使用 Python3 ftplib 下载文件 ## 引言 作为一名经验丰富的开发者,教导刚入行的小白如何实现“python3 ftplib下载”是一项很有意义的任务。在本文中,我将向你展示整个下载文件的流程,并说明每一步需要做什么以及使用的代码。 ### 1. 流程概述 在使用 Python3 ftplib 下载文件的过程中,主要包括连接到 FTP 服务器、选择要下载文件下载文件
原创 2024-03-16 06:56:46
145阅读
先删除文件夹中所有文件file1 = os.getcwd().replace('\\', '/') # 获取当前工作目录 print(file1) file2 = file1[0:file1.find('/Desktop')] file_dir = os.path.join(file2, 'Downloads/').repl
  • 1
  • 2
  • 3
  • 4
  • 5